WebThe egg is laid in form of clusters and covered with gelatinous secretion of the female noth which helps them in proper attachment. Egg : The eggs laid by the female moth are rounded and white in colour. The weght of the newly laid 2,000 eggs comes to about 1 gm. With the increase in time after laying. Eggs become darker. WebNov 3, 2024 · Eggs of Antherea frithi are cream yellow with a brownish band, they’re laid in number of 148-176 and they hatch in about 1-2 weeks depending on temperatures (1 week at 28°C). First instars caterpillars are brown, then they become yellowish before the first molt. Growing, they develop white and then black setae in tubercles.
